One of the biggest stressors for small business owners is money. Learning quickly how to handle cashflow is crucial for business owners soon after setting up their business. Getting paid on time, being responsible for employees’ incomes, or making risky financial decisions, are all common challenges for businesses.

This episode talks through some of the struggles and stressors small business owners face when managing finances, how these can impact your mental health, and that it is OK to make mistakes as long as you address them early and put practices into place that mitigate risk.
